Pedro Rovetto is a musician, producer, and sound engineer with more than 20 years of experience in the music industry. He has worked with artists such as Bomba Estéreo, LosPetitFellas, and Aterciopelados, with whom he has received a total of three nominations and an award for Best Alternative Music Album for “Claroscura”.
In addition, he is a certified Ableton Live trainer, with which he has been a teacher and speaker at different universities such as the Fernando Sor University, Javeriana University, ICESI University, and SAE. He has also taught courses for the Árbol Naranja studio in Bogotá and has given conferences for state events such as Colombia 4.0 (Ministry of ICT's).
